Abstract

The study aimed to assess the fresh harvest and physiological maturity of
red long bean lines at several harvest ages. The study was conducted in
Sumbersoko Village, RT.10/RW.01, Sukolilo, Pati and the Plant Physiology and
Breeding Laboratory, Faculty of Animal and Agricultural Sciences, Universitas
Diponegoro, from November 2024 to February 2025.
The research design used was a split plot design applied to a randomized
block design with 7 F7 generation long bean lines (FA 1–1–4–3–6–8–B, FS 3–4
7–1–B, FA 3–2–13–14–B, FA 1–1–5–3–18–B, FA 1–1–10–1–6, FS 3–4–10–3
B And FS 3–4–8–2–B), elders long beans (Fagiola IPB and Aura Hijau) as the
main plot, and harvest time (8, 11, 14, 17, 20, 23, 26, 29, 32 And 35 day after
anthesis (HSA)) as a child plot. Test repeated 3 time, parameter Which observed
that is long pods, fresh weight of pods/plant, number of pods/plant, number of
seeds/pod, germination capacity, seed water content, sweetness level, pod shelf
life, pod shape, texture pod, color pod, color end pod, color seed main, secondary
seed color and seed shape. Qualitative data were analyzed descriptively,
quantitative data were analyzed descriptively. use Analysis of Variance Which to
be continued test Different Real Honesty level 5%, as well as correlation analysis
and path analysis.
The results of the study indicate that the lines have different qualitative and
quantitative characteristics at certain harvest ages. Fresh harvesting produces red
purple pods ( greyed-purple group RHS 187 and purple group RHS N77) with
end pod green yellowish ( yellow-green RHS group 145), while harvesting Cook
physiological own color pod And color end pod brownish ( brown group RHS
200). All producing strains seed color main and seed color secondary Which
different. Line influential significant to The parameters were pod length, fresh pod
weight/plant, number of pods/plant, seed weight/pod, and sweetness level. Harvest
age had a significant effect on all parameters. The interaction between strain and
harvest age had a significant effect on weight fresh pods/plants, amount
pods/plants, Power germination, and sweetness level. A significant correlation and
contribution were shown between sweetness level and the shelf life of fresh pods,
as well as water content with germination power and seed number. The conclusion
of this study is that there is a significant effect of harvest age on the shelf life of
fresh pods. 8 And 11 HSA on 2 strain, 11 And 14 HSA on 3 strain, harvest 11 HSA
on 1 line and harvest 8, 11 and 14 on 1 line. Physiologically ripe harvesting can be
done age 20, 23 And 26 HSA on 3 strain as well as 20 And 23 HSA on 4 strain.
